Fj. Kramer et Sx. Bai, OPTIMAL-CONTROL OF A PRODUCTION SYSTEM WITH PERIODIC MAINTENANCE, Optimal control applications & methods, 17(4), 1996, pp. 281-307

In this paper we consider a production system consisting of one machin
e for which maintenance is performed on a periodic basis. When the mac
hine is undergoing maintenance, the system is shut down and cannot pro
duce. One part-type is produced and the demand rate is assumed to be c
onstant. In order to make on-time delivery, the objective is to produc
e following the demand as closely as possible. However, the maintenanc
e disruptions make the production deviate from the demand. We formulat
e the production flow control problem as an optimal control model and
use Pontryagin's minimum principle to solve the special case of one up
-down cycle. We then solve the general N-cycle problem based on the on
e-cycle solution.
